Output 86db328477a00804f2934406caed5f298a92f5da82ebbd38c5ab5f447d40e1eb:6

value
589950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 919786e7c3179843426f447a5c5c274713a7e16d OP_EQUAL
address
3ExqRdx6feDVLU85X7xYSasevBzKpozYn1
transaction
86db328477a00804f2934406caed5f298a92f5da82ebbd38c5ab5f447d40e1eb
spent
true